Schwinn 2891 Series pull describes a handle designed by Schwinn Hardware for decorative cabinet and furniture applications, so it serves as the grasp point where doors and drawers are opened and closed in daily use. The 2-1/2 in (64 mm) center to center dimension fixes the distance between the mounting holes, which lets installers align this pull with layouts drilled on a 64 mm boring pattern. The satin nickel performance finish defines the surface appearance and treatment, so the pull presents a satin nickel look that coordinates with other satin nickel decorative hardware in a project. The manufacturer part number 59055 identifies this exact 2891 Series version, which helps shops and installers reorder the same handle style for repeat jobs or for matching existing installations. Being part of the Handles and Pulls product class focuses this item on operating cabinet fronts rather than acting as structural hardware.
